Plumbing professionals, pipefitters, and steamfitters finish an instruction program and pass the needed licensing examination to end up being journey-level workers


Plumbing professionals with numerous years of pipes experience that pass one more exam make master status. Some states require master plumbing professional condition in order to acquire a pipes service provider's license. Many states and some localities call for plumbers to be licensed. Although licensing demands vary, states and localities usually call for employees to have 2 to 5 years of experience and to pass an examination that shows their expertise of the profession before enabling plumbers to function independently.


In enhancement, a lot of companies require plumbings to have a motorist's license. Some states call for pipefitters and steamfitters to be accredited; they may also require a special permit to function on gas lines - Water Filtration Systems.

To become a certified journeyman-level plumbing professional, most states need a four-year duration functioning as a pupil or trainee. Washington State, for instance, needs 8,000 hours working under a certified journeyman plumbing technician.

After a plumbing professional has finished the student period, they need to pass a licensing licensing test. The examination covers the existing Attire Pipes Code in order to end up being a licensed plumber - https://lwccareers.lindsey.edu/profiles/3828299-ronnie-hood. To prepare for the licensing test, candidates may intend to take a program at a trade institution or otherwise execute structured study methods
